What the allowance actually buys

One allowance here buys 200,450 EXP, which places it 3rd of the 3 Lv 50 Goldsmith tradecraft leves that record EXP. The best of them, The Goggles, They Do Naught, returns 334,080 EXP for the same allowance, 67% more.

Across that rung the return runs from 200,450 EXP to 334,080 EXP per allowance — 3 distinct figures spanning 67%, so the wrong pick leaves 133,630 EXP of the allowance unspent.

On whether to wait: the best Lv 52 Goldsmith tradecraft leve returns 629,850 EXP per allowance, 89% more than the best on this rung, while the Lv 45 rung behind tops out at 137,400 EXP.

At Lv 50 this data holds 54 leves paying EXP across 3 categories: the 24 Tradecraft ones average 238,216 EXP per allowance, the 3 Fieldcraft ones 834,862 EXP and the 27 Grand Company ones 132,961 EXP, which puts this leve 16% below its own category's average.

Yeti Staff ×1 is a Lv 51 Goldsmith recipe, 3 steps deep through 4 intermediates, costing 20 units of raw material and 27 crystals.

Handing that in returns 10,023 EXP and 12 gil for every unit of raw material the order swallows, and the tree needs Alchemist, Carpenter and Goldsmith.

The record carries a repeats value of 2. This site reads that as 2 further turn-ins on the same leve — an assumption, because the source data defines no meaning for the field — which would put the ceiling at 601,350 EXP and 744 gil for the 1 allowance it costs, or 601,350 EXP per allowance.

Raw bill for the whole turn-in: Raw Agate ×6, Cedar Log ×5, Gelato Flesh ×3, Basilisk Egg ×2, Pudding Flesh ×2, Yeti Fang ×2
